The Engineering Marvel: A Spiral of Genius

The Brusio Spiral Viaduct is a testament to early 20th-century Swiss engineering prowess. Opened in 1908, this single-track, loop-shaped railway viaduct was ingeniously designed to overcome the steep gradient of the Poschiavo Valley. Instead of a conventional tunnel or a much longer, less picturesque route, engineers opted for a 360-degree spiral, allowing the Rhaetian Railway to gain altitude gradually and safely. The structure is composed of nine stone arches, blending seamlessly with the natural landscape. Its unique design is so remarkable that it's a key component of the UNESCO World Heritage Site designation for the Rhaetian Railway in the Albula/Bernina Landscapes. Instagram+2

This architectural feat allows trains, including the famous Bernina Express, to make a complete circle, effectively climbing or descending a significant elevation difference within a relatively short distance. The train slows down considerably as it navigates the spiral, providing passengers with an unforgettable experience and ample time to admire the surrounding alpine scenery and the viaduct itself. It's a prime example of how innovative design can harmonize with nature while solving complex logistical challenges. InstagramReddit

Experiencing the Brusio Spiral Viaduct via Train

The most iconic way to experience the Brusio Spiral Viaduct is aboard the Bernina Express or other Rhaetian Railway (RhB) trains that traverse the Bernina Line. The journey itself is a UNESCO World Heritage experience, winding through breathtaking alpine scenery. As the train approaches Brusio, it begins its slow, deliberate spiral. Passengers are advised to sit on specific sides of the train for the best views: the left side when traveling north from Tirano, and the right side when traveling south from Chur. InstagramReddit

The train's speed is significantly reduced as it enters and navigates the viaduct, allowing for unparalleled photo opportunities. Many travelers find that standing near the carriage doors (where permitted and safe) offers even better perspectives, capturing the train's movement around the loop. This deliberate slowing down is not just for the view; it's essential for the train to safely complete the tight curve. InstagramReddit

Booking tickets for the Bernina Express in advance is crucial, especially during peak seasons, as seats are limited and highly sought after. Even if you're not on the Bernina Express, regional trains on the same line also stop at Brusio and offer a similar, though perhaps less leisurely, experience of the viaduct. Hiking Trails for Unique Perspectives

For those who wish to see the Brusio Spiral Viaduct from a different angle, the surrounding Poschiavo Valley offers several well-marked hiking trails. These routes provide opportunities to appreciate the viaduct's scale and its integration into the landscape from ground level. The Brusio Circular Trail is an easy, family-friendly option, taking about 1 to 1.5 hours to complete a loop that includes views of the viaduct. Reddit

More adventurous hikers can opt for longer trails like the Poschiavo to Brusio Trail (2-2.5 hours) or the Cavaglia to Brusio Trail (4-5 hours). These paths wind through meadows, forests, and traditional Swiss villages, offering a deeper immersion into the natural beauty of the region. The Lago di Poschiavo to Brusio Trail is another moderate option, starting near the picturesque lake. Reddit

These hiking experiences not only offer stunning photographic opportunities of the viaduct but also allow visitors to connect with the local environment and discover the charm of the Swiss Alps beyond the train window. Remember to wear appropriate footwear and check trail conditions before setting out. InstagramReddit
